Verdi’s Il trovatore blazes with passion, vengeance, and the unstoppable force of fate. At its heart is a search for identity, as each character struggles to confront who they truly are, and the secrets that define them. As past secrets collide with present rivalries, Verdi’s electrifying music drives the drama forward with soaring arias, stirring choruses, and unrelenting intensity. Known by opera lovers and newcomers alike through music gems like Act II’s “Anvil Chorus”, Il trovatore is a true grand opera, full of political intrigue, mistaken identity, love, revenge, obsession, and onstage battles!

In the shadow of 15th Century Spain, political machinations, true love, revenge, and obsession come full force. Enter a world where past and present are bound by fire and memory. In Il trovatore, a long-buried tragedy sets the stage for a deadly conflict between two men who do not know how deeply their lives are intertwined. Manrico, a troubadour and rebel, is fiercely devoted to Azucena, the woman who raised him. Opposing him is Count di Luna, a powerful nobleman driven by jealousy and an unrelenting desire for vengeance. Between them stands Leonora, whose love for Manrico draws her into a world of danger, sacrifice, and impossible choices. What unfolds is a story of devotion and destruction, where love offers fleeting hope against the weight of fate, and where the truth, when it finally emerges, changes everything.
